Prowler
TOP PICKOpen-source cloud security posture scanning with framework check packs.
Scans AWS, Azure, GCP and Kubernetes against hundreds of checks and maps them to compliance frameworks including CIS, SOC 2, HIPAA, GDPR and NIST. Runs as a CLI in CI or as a self-hosted app, and produces the technical-control evidence a compliance platform would otherwise gather for you.
OpenSCAP
SCAP-standard configuration scanning and hardening for Linux estates.
The reference implementation of SCAP, with profiles for CIS benchmarks, DISA STIG and PCI DSS. Where the estate is Linux servers rather than cloud APIs, this is the long-established way to prove hosts are hardened to a named standard.

Prowler
Strengths
- +Framework mappings are built in — SOC 2, CIS, HIPAA, GDPR, NIST and more, not just raw findings
- +Runs in CI, so posture is checked on every change rather than the week before an audit
- +Covers the part of compliance that is genuinely automatable: technical control state
Trade-offs
- −Produces evidence, not an audit — no auditor relationship, no report
- −No policy management, security training tracking or vendor review workflow
- −Someone has to own the findings; the tool will not chase them
OpenSCAP
Strengths
- +An actual standard, recognised by auditors in regulated environments
- +Ships with Red Hat and Debian ecosystems; no new vendor
- +Remediation guidance, not only findings
Trade-offs
- −Host-level only — blind to cloud service configuration
- −Tooling and profile editing feel dated next to the cloud-native options
- −Narrow: one part of one control family
